Pj B.asked
Which oil is best to use
1 answer
For the 4-stroke Briggs and Stratton, it needs an SAE30 Oil, such as Valvoline Power Armour 4-Stroke, available at Bunnings.

David.Basked
My Victa Hurricane has an M/N HMS466 sticker on the engine. When I look up the models I can fined HMS 462 ( 2 Stroke) and HMS464 (4 Stroke). Can you tell me what my no. means.
1 answer
HMS466 is your model number for the Victa Hurricane with the 600-series Briggs & Stratton 4-stroke engine. HMS462 is the Victa Hurricane with the 2-stroke engine, and the HMS464 is the Victa Hurricane with 400- or 500-Series B&S Engine
